Chapter 55 Please give me a name

 He ​​Qingxuan was very uncomfortable being looked at by Chen Ping.

He rubbed his head and pretended to be stupid: "What does it have to do with me? Isn't this the person you bought?"

Chen Ping took his arm and begged: "Brother He, do good things to the end!"

"I'm not from a family where I can have servants. How can I support them if I let them follow me?"

"I don't even have a place to put them!"

Chen Pingcai also had a moment of heroism, but now he realized that he was acting recklessly.

He knows what is going on in his family. Ye Chongwen is too young and has almost no say in the Ye family.

If it weren't for a rich man like He Qingxuan by his side, given the current situation of himself and Ye Chongwen, it would indeed be a very difficult thing to save people to the end.

So, of course, all the pressure came to He Qingxuan.

As the oldest, richest and most well-connected among his friends, Chen Ping was naturally capable of handling this matter. Chen Ping could only ask He Qingxuan for help.

He Qingxuan shook his head helplessly and said: "Okay, okay, I admit it!"

"Then tell me, how do you want me to arrange for the two brothers and sisters?"

"Let's talk about it first. If we go directly to the He family's master's house, we need the consent of the elders in the family. I can't be the master. I can do my best for other things."

Even though you are just an ordinary servant entering the He family's house, even this kind of opportunity is usually reserved for the servants of the He family to have children.

If you are a servant bought from outside, you have to at least train in a shop or workshop under the name of the He family for three to five years before you have a chance.

This does not come from anyone's request, but is a rule of almost all clans. Even if He Qingxuan has a high status in the family, he cannot easily change it.

But no matter where they work, the two brothers and sisters will definitely be much better than they are now.

Chen Ping did not make his own decisions, but turned around and asked them about their wishes.

The little boy had woken up from the drastic change in his identity and immediately pulled his sister to kneel on the ground.

He said sincerely: "You saved my life and my sister's, sir. From now on, your life and death will be decided by you."

"Although I am young, I still have a lot of strength, so please feel free to use it!"

Although the words were spoken in a lowly manner, there was a sense of arrogance and deep determination in his tone, which did not sound like a duplicitous person.

The little boy is trying his best to prove his worth, lest his brother and sister fall into a situation of nowhere to stay again just after they escape from the tiger's mouth.

Chen Ping naturally understood their thoughts, so he quickly pulled them up and asked solemnly.

"I want to know first, what do you and your sister want to do for a living?"

"Do you want to find a wealthy family to work as a servant or maid in order to have a relaxed and comfortable life? Or do you want to be an apprentice in a shop or workshop and try your best to learn a way to make a living by yourself?"

"You have to remember that your answer can almost determine the future of your brother and sister, at least the future for a long time to come. You must be cautious!"

Chen Ping posed the problem to the little boy without any suggestion or guidance.

He doesn't want his likes and dislikes to influence the little boy's choices.

The other party fell silent and did not answer in a hurry.

Seeing this scene, Chen Ping and the other three nodded slightly.

Although this man is down and out, he is indeed not a fool.

The little boy lowered his head and thought hard, while the little girl gently pulled her brother's hand.

The little girl raised her head for the first time and secretly looked at Chen Ping, who had saved her life, as if she was trying to remember the face of her savior.

Chen Ping glanced at her subconsciously, and she immediately lowered her head again, timidly.

The little boy thought for a while and replied.

"We will let the young master make arrangements, and we will obey no matter what."

"If we really have to choose ourselves, we are willing to eat what we earn with our own hands!"

The stubborn look in his eyes and these words of self-improvement made Chen Ping agree with him.

Such a spirit is not often seen in this world.

For most poor people, being able to enter a wealthy family and become a servant, with enough food, clothing and warmth is already a dream.

As for dignity and freedom, most people don't have the energy to pay attention to it. Long-term wandering will wear away their temperament.

Chen Ping's eyes met the little boy's, and the clear eyes on his gray-black face were very conspicuous, and he could vaguely see a trace of himself in them.

Then he said: "Okay, I respect your opinion!"

Then he turned to look at He Qingxuan and asked for his opinion.

The other party twitched his face and looked like he was just obeying.

"Okay, I'll send a message to my family right now, asking someone to pick up the brothers and sisters, and take them to our He family's dyeing workshop."

"When you get there, you can do odd jobs first. Once you gain some strength and become familiar with the basic operating procedures, you can then become an apprentice."

"As for whether they can learn a craft, it depends on their own luck and their own efforts."

The dyeing workshop is one of the main businesses of the He family, and it is indeed an excellent place.

As for whether he can learn the craft, this is not He Qingxuan’s deliberate shirk.

Those masters who truly have craftsmanship will not easily teach things that are related to their own jobs, especially to these two foreign "wild children".

Sometimes, even the masters who employ them cannot order them to take apprentices.

The purpose is to prevent the disciples of the church from starving to death and the master.

Seeing that He Qingxuan had already agreed, Chen Ping immediately reminded him.

"I haven't thanked Mr. He yet, this is your future young master's house."

The little boy and his sister knelt on the ground and kowtowed three times to the three of them.

He said loudly: "Thank you three gentlemen. My sister and I will remember this kindness forever!"

He Qingxuan and Ye Chongwen said quickly, just remember Chen Ping, he was the one who saved you.

Chen Ping looked at the contract in his hand and was slightly stunned.

The two names written by the juggler on the sales contract were actually Li Huazi and Li Xiaoya.

Even if it is easy to make a living with a cheap name, not many biological parents would name their son Hanako, right?

Chen Ping asked in confusion: "Your real name is Li Huazi?"

Hearing this, the little boy's eyes turned red again. This name was full of humiliation and randomness for him.

He clenched his fists, looked at the direction the class leader was leaving, and said angrily: "The class leader's surname was Li, so he gave us these two names casually."

"We are orphans with no name and no surname. Now our lives belong to you, Master. Please give us a new name!"

Name it?

A name can be regarded as the shortest spell, something that will be chanted for a lifetime.

In a sense, it may also affect a person's life.

Never be hasty!

Chen Ping has never been a parent in his two lifetimes and has no experience in naming people.

At this moment, I was stumped.
